Paul, the revenge syndrom on E-bay cannot be avoided. I had it happen
several years ago when i first started using E-bay. A seller really
screwed me on a deal and I left negative feed back. He in turn left a
searing feedback for me. Nowdays unless a seller does something really
outstanding I don't leave feedback at all, even if they beg for it.
